I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Vee Henry
"Gabby" Smith
November 20, 1938 – January 20, 2012
Hurricane, Utah - Vee "Gabby" Henry Smith, 73, rode off into the sunset on January 20, 2012 in Hurricane, Utah. He was born on November 21, 1938 in Henrieville, Utah to Robert Earl Smith and Caroline Evelyn Goulding. He married Judith Ann Highers on December 13th, 1975 and settled in Hurricane.
He was born and raised in Henrieville, Utah where he explored the country by horseback. After leaving Henrieville, he traveled around, mostly in Utah doing various jobs. He served in the US Army, handled mules at Bryce Canyon and the North Rim of the Grand Canyon, worked cattle in Southern Utah and Northern Arizona, was an electrician, a foreman on a farm, and was the custodian of the Hurricane Senior Citizen's Center for 17 years before retiring in 2011. But his true love was being a cowboy. He loved being on a horse. He enjoyed taking road trips, especially to see his grandchildren. He enjoyed reading, working jigsaw puzzles, watching basketball, mainly the Utah Jazz, rodeos and horse racing.
He is survived by his wife, Judy; children, David (Holly) Johns of West Jordan, Utah, Dale (Jennifer) Johns of Land O' Lakes, Florida, Dan Smith of Hurricane, Utah, Dean Smith of Hurricane, Utah; 5 grandchildren: Breanna Johns, Kyle Johns, Brooklyn Johns, Braxton Johns, Brighton Johns; brother, Roe (Colleen) Smith; sisters: Ida Stoddard, Joy Kirk, Loa (Max) Sevy; and numerous n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his brothers and sister: Guy Smith, Don Smith, Lee Smith, Jed Smith, Van Smith and Amy Clark.
